Virtual Intensive Outpatient Programs (IOPs) offer a vital solution, providing structured therapy sessions from the comfort of home.
For those living in Woodinville, the Virtual IOP model is particularly beneficial. It allows residents to engage in therapeutic services without the stress of commuting, making it easier to maintain work, school, and family commitments. Offering evidence-based treatments like Cognitive Behavioral Therapy (CBT) and Dialectical Behavior Therapy (DBT), these programs ensure that individuals receive effective care tailored to their specific needs, whether dealing with anxiety, depression, or substance use issues.
Getting started with a Virtual IOP is simple. Residents can find programs that accept their insurance and specialize in the conditions they are facing. Typically, these programs involve 9-20 hours of therapy each week, with options for individual, group, and family sessions. Many licensed professionals are available to guide individuals on their path to recovery, ensuring a supportive and therapeutic environment.
